| Output Format | Best use case |
|---|---|
| Direct URL | Embed inside forums, web layouts, direct CDN loading |
| Share page URL | Copy to Slack, Discord, email chains, client communication |
| HTML code | CMS editors, personal blogs, dashboard inserts |
| Markdown code | GitHub issues, pull requests, README documentations |
| BBCode | Classic community message boards and forums |
